It is possible to define constants on a per-class basis remaining the same and unchangeable. The default visibility of class constants is public.. Note: . Class constants can be redefined by a child class. As of PHP 8.1.0, class constants cannot be redefined by a child class if it is defined as final.. It's also possible for interfaces to have …

Introduction. ¶. This extension filters data by either validating or sanitizing it. This is especially useful when the data source contains unknown (or foreign) data, like user supplied input. For example, this data may come from an HTML form. This abstract iterator filters out unwanted values. This class should be extended to implement custom iterator filters. The FilterIterator::accept() must be implemented in the subclass. Please give us a description of what …There are three access modifiers: public - the property or method can be accessed from everywhere. This is default. protected - the property or method can be accessed within the class and by classes derived from that class. private - the property or method can ONLY be accessed within the class.
